Abstract
Large - scale turbulent flow structures associated with positive and negative wall pressure fluctuations in a compressible turbulent boundary layer are investigated. Experiments are conducted in a closed-loop transonic wind tunnel at Ma = 0.5 - 0.8, Ret=5,100-9,500 with combined velocity field and wall pressure measurements. Both velocity and pressure statistics are analysed and compare well with existing low Mach number data. Spatial two-point correlation is applied to determine the size and orientation of the large - scale flow structures, which depending on the wall height have an averaged length scales of 4-6 δ and a maximum inclination angel of ≈ 12o - 13o . The wall pressure fluctuations are associated with shear layer structures and it is shown that positive pressure fluctuations are correlated with low speed large - scale flow structure over streamwise extents of 4 - 5 δ.
